> It appears urlFor(behavior,interface) is not making the url for the behavior
> but rather the component the behavior is on

> While on IRC Igor gave an example of a behavior:
> http://papernapkin.org/pastebin/view/4672 to generate an onClick event for a
> table row.
> The onclick string in this needs to be augmented a bit to:
> window.location='"+url+"';";
> However, in the end I get a exception:
> WicketMessage: Method onLinkClicked of interface
> wicket.markup.html.link.ILinkListener targeted at component ..
> java.lang.IllegalArgumentException: object is not an instance of declaring
> class
